Description

Thioacetylmalonic Acid Diethyl Ester is a versatile sulfur-containing organic building block, primarily valued for its role as a key intermediate in heterocyclic synthesis. Its unique structure, featuring both thioester and active methylene functionalities, makes it a critical reagent for constructing complex molecular architectures. This compound is essential for research and development chemists in the pharmaceutical and agrochemical industries, where it is used to synthesize novel active ingredients and fine chemicals.

Application

  • Pharmaceutical Intermediate: A key precursor in the synthesis of thiophene, pyridine, and other nitrogen/sulfur-containing heterocycles with potential biological activity.
  • Agrochemical Synthesis: Used in the development of novel herbicides, fungicides, and insecticides that require specific sulfur-based heterocyclic cores.
  • Material Science Research: Serves as a monomer or building block for creating specialized polymers and organic electronic materials.
  • Organic Synthesis Reagent: Employed in Knoevenagel condensations, Michael additions, and other C-C bond-forming reactions due to its active methylene group.
  • Chemical Research & Development: A valuable tool for medicinal chemists and process chemists exploring new synthetic routes and molecular scaffolds.

Basic Information

Product Name Thioacetylmalonic Acid Diethyl Ester
CAS No. 18457-90-4
Molecular Formula C9H14O4S
Molecular Weight 218.27 g/mol
Synonyms Diethyl 2-(Acetylthio)malonate; Acetylthio Malonic Acid Diethyl Ester; 2-(Acetylthio)malonic Acid Diethyl Ester; Diethyl Acetylthiomalonate; Malonic Acid, 2-(Acetylthio)-, Diethyl Ester; Acetylthiomalonic Acid Diethyl Ester; Thioacetyl Malonic Acid Diethyl Ester; ATDE
EINECS 242-334-8

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). Keep away from strong bases and incompatible materials. For long-term storage, consider storing under an inert atmosphere to maintain optimal stability.
